The Ultimate Guide to STD Fantasy Football Meaning: Decode the Jargon and Win!

STD fantasy football refers to standard scoring formats in fantasy football leagues where points are awarded based on real player performance statistics. This structure defines how leagues track touchdowns, yards, field goals, and other on field actions to rank managers and teams.

Understanding the core principles of std fantasy football helps both new and experienced owners interpret box scores, league standings, and waiver wire value with confidence.

Core Mechanics of STD Fantasy Football

How Scoring Shapes Roster Decisions

In std fantasy football, scoring settings are typically locked to real league values, such as 6 points for a touchdown and 1 point per 10 rushing or receiving yards. These predictable benchmarks make it easier to compare players, set lineups, and evaluate trades without constantly adjusting for exotic rules.

Because standard leagues emphasize volume stats, managers often target high usage runners, red zone targets, and reliable third down options. Positional tiers and bye weeks matter more when scoring is consistent, leading to steadier weekly planning.

Draft Preparation in Standard Settings

Preparing for a std fantasy football draft means focusing on scarcity at premium positions like quarterback and wide receiver. Early round value often shifts toward running backs with high carry volumes and wideouts with proven route running in pass friendly schemes.

Knowing your league scoring thresholds, such as the minimum yardage for a touchdown or the frequency of red zone opportunities, helps you grade mock draft outcomes and adjust to your table specific tendencies.

Impact of League Settings and Roster Size

How Format Influences Player Availability

The size of your roster and scoring thresholds directly affect how you view std fantasy football positions. In larger leagues with more teams, the supply of quality starters shrinks, making backups and handcuffs more valuable on the waiver wire.

Smaller rosters often force managers to prioritize high end talent at fewer spots, while larger formats reward depth and flexible options that can fill in during injuries or tough matchups each week.

Practice Roster Management in Standard Scoring

Active roster limits in std fantasy football encourage owners to think in terms of clear starters, swing players, and situational options. Streaming tight ends or flexible wide receivers can optimize weekly point totals without bloating the bench.

Tracking injury reports, practice participation, and matchup analytics becomes essential when roster moves are limited and every slot must justify its spot on game day.

Advanced Strategy and Weekly Optimization

Consistent std fantasy football scoring makes it easier to evaluate player trends and identify reliable starters. By reviewing season long averages, red zone usage, and snap counts, managers can forecast expected production each week.

Setting a baseline projection and then adjusting for opponent strength, weather, and rest days helps owners avoid emotional decisions during busy game days and late deadline changes.

Waiver Wire and Trade Decisions

In standard leagues, value on the waiver wire often follows predictable patterns based on scoring settings and positional scarcity. Owners who understand how yardage thresholds and touchdown bonuses affect market prices can capitalize on overlooked players.

When considering trades, compare projected point differentials under your league rules, accounting for roster flexibility, remaining schedule, and future draft capital.

What does STD mean in fantasy football leagues?

STD stands for standard, referring to leagues that use traditional scoring rules aligned with official statistics, such as 6 points per touchdown and 1 point per 10 yards.

How can I compare players fairly in standard scoring formats?

Use consistent metrics like points per snap, red zone rate, and yards per carry, while adjusting for schedule strength and team context to level the playing field.

Are there risks to relying solely on standard scoring analytics?

Yes, over reliance on past stats can miss emerging trends, rule changes, or injury risks, so balance data with film study and up to date news before making roster moves.

What are common mistakes new owners make in std fantasy football drafts?

Early round reach plays at non premium positions, ignoring bye week distribution, and overvaluing recent small sample size performances can derail a season long strategy.
